The houses in this part of Mexico are delightful. The architecture is a fascinating mix of traditional and adventuresome. There is a house across the street here that has an onion dome. There is tilework trim on a house down the street that makes the brick structure into some sort of fairy-tale jewelry box. The cheerful face the houses put on is undercut a bit by the bars and razorwire that adorn many of them, but I’m told people find all that extra security both prudent and necessary.

The house in the picture is the most felicitous melding of security and exuberance I’ve ever seen. I dare you not to wonder what this house looks like inside, or to wonder about its jolly owners. I mean, they’d have to be jolly, wouldn’t they?
